Batman 66 is a comic book series published by dc comics featuring batman as a continuation of the 196668 television series starring adam west and burt ward as batman and robin. Batman 66 is a digital and hardcopy dc comic book series published from 20 to 2016, featuring new stories set in the continuity of the batman 1966 liveaction tv series from 1966.
